Daniel García-Donoso

Dr García-Donoso’s main research interests lie in the field of cultural production and intellectual history of modern and contemporary Spain. His book Escrituras post-seculares (Biblioteca Nueva, 2018) argues that, far from being increasingly marginal, religion and religious questions lie at the heart of an extensive corpus of narrative fiction in Spain and constitute a fundamental expression of a post-secular culture. He has also co-edited a volume titled The Sacred and Modernity in Urban Spain: Beyond the Secular City (Palgrave, 2016). His research has appeared in journals such as Romance Studies, Revista de Estudios Hispánicos and Afro-Hispanic Review.
